The internet portal AllAboutJazz once counted Dutchman Harmen Fraanje among the most impressive young European pianists of the last decade. Why is that? Perhaps because this virtuoso is so versatile, always thinking beyond the horizon and constantly searching for new sources of inspiration and means of expression. However, no one should confuse the versatility of the fundamentally curious Harmen Fraanje with arbitrariness. The sound world of this pianist is as colorful as it is homogeneous.

Harmen Fraanje is rightly responsible for the jazz piano faculty at the Amsterdam Conservatory. You can only learn from him. He has developed his musical world view and vision in solo projects, in a trio with the cellist Ernst Reijseger and the percussionist/vocalist Mola Sylla, in a duo with the Norwegian trumpeter Arve Henriksen, in the Mads Eilertsen Trio, Eric Vloieman's Fugimundi Trio, Michael Moore's Fraglie Quartet and in various formations with highly diverse instrumentation and stylistic orientations.
